Subpanel Installation in Provo, UT
Subpanel installation services involve adding a secondary electrical panel to a property, typically to support additional circuits or appliances. This service is often requested for home expansions, garage conversions, or when upgrading an existing electrical system to meet increased power demands. Property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, including where the subpanel will be located, how it connects to the main electrical panel, and what safety considerations are involved. Proper planning ensures that the subpanel will provide reliable power while complying with local electrical codes and standards.
Before requesting subpanel installation, property owners should consider the current capacity of their main electrical panel and whether an upgrade is necessary. It’s also helpful to clarify which areas or appliances will be powered by the new subpanel, as this influences its size and configuration. Understanding the typical process, including permits and inspections, can help ensure the project proceeds smoothly. Consulting with a professional can provide valuable guidance on selecting the right subpanel and ensuring the installation aligns with safety and electrical requirements.

Subpanel Installation Questions
What is a subpanel? A subpanel is an additional electrical panel that provides extra circuit capacity for a property, often used to support additions or outbuildings.
Why install a subpanel? Installing a subpanel helps distribute electrical loads more efficiently and allows for easier access to circuits in different areas of a property.
Where should a subpanel be located? A subpanel should be placed in a convenient, accessible location close to the areas it serves, while complying with local electrical codes.
What types of projects typically require a subpanel? Subpanels are commonly used for home additions, garage or workshop wiring, or when existing panels are nearing capacity.
